US OptionsDetailed Quotes

MSTR241206P327500

Watchlist
  • 3.10
  • -1.53-33.05%
15min DelayClose Dec 3 16:00 ET
5.68High2.00Low

MicroStrategy Stock Discussion

Sign in to post a comment

No comment yet